Blueberry Frozen Yogurt FroYo Bites with Granola

Make these FroYo bites for a healthy treat on a hot day! It's perfect for kids and adults alike.

Recipe type: Dessert
Serves: 6
Ingredients
  • 1 Cup Granola
  • ¼ Cup Melted Butter or Melted Coconut Oil
  • 3.5 Ounces Blueberry Greek Yogurt (or any other flavor)
  • ½ Cup Blueberries (or other fresh for frozen berries)
Instructions
  1. In a bowl, combine the granola and melted butter. Crush the granola into smaller bits if the chunks are too large.
  2. Stir and let sit for around five minutes so that the granola soaks up the butter.
  3. Using a silicone mold (I used a floral shaped one for Spring) fill each hole about halfway with granola and use the back of the spoon to pack it down.
  4. Stir the greek yogurt well and fill each hole the rest of the way to the top.
  5. Put 2-4 blueberries on the top of each yogurt bite and press them down so they sit into the yogurt.
  6. Place in the freezer for 1-3 hours or until firm.
